EUA Report on doctoral programs in Europe
Fabrice Martin, translation by Cynthia Schoch
The European University Association (EUA) has published a report entitled “Doctoral Programmes in Europe's Universities: Achievements and Challenges."Emphasizing the need to attract and keep top quality young researchers in Europe, the EUA in particular recommends that universities and public authorities improve supervision and assessment practices, promote international doctoral researcher mobility and include transferable skills development at every level of doctoral education.
Doctoral Programmes in Europe's Universities: Achievements and Challenges, report prepared for European universities and ministers of higher education, European University Association, 2007.
